About the Role The Data & Analytics team at Scribd is seeking a Lead Data Scientist to drive the strategy behind how Scribd discovers, prioritizes, and invests in content. Sitting at the intersection of content, product, and business, this role is both highly strategic and deeply technical — with direct impact on how millions of users engage with our global content library. Scribd is a differentiated subscription platform with strong organic reach and a vast content catalog, spanning books, audiobooks, and over 100 million user-generated documents and slides. In a world where AI is rapidly changing content discovery, summarization, and creation, our challenge — and opportunity — is to use data to help users cut through the noise and engage with high-quality, human-centered content. In this high-impact, cross-functional role, you’ll partner across Content, Product, and Engineering to build models, experiments, and frameworks that surface the right content to the right users — and guide strategic investments in both premium and UGC content. You’ll shape how we define content value, how we measure content ROI, and how we evolve our platform alongside emerging technologies like GenAI. This is a rare opportunity to influence not just what content we bring onto the platform, but how it reaches and resonates with a global audience — at a moment of rapid transformation in the content landscape. You Will - Define and evolve content valuation frameworks, quantifying impact through both user engagement and business ROI lenses. - Identify key user engagement signals and build predictive or causal models to evaluate content performance across the user lifecycle — from trial to activation, retention, and long-term value. - Design and analyze experiments that measure content impact on conversion, churn, monetization, and LTV. - Partner with Product Managers to enhance content curation, discovery, personalization, and engagement — leveraging emerging machine learning techniques such as GenAI where applicable to drive innovation. - Collaborate with the Content Deals team to inform acquisition and licensing strategies using robust, data-backed insights. - Present findings and strategic recommendations to stakeholders across Product, Engineering, Content, and Executive teams. - Partner with Data Engineering and Analytics to ensure key content metrics are accurate, scalable, and accessible across the business. - Contribute to broader data science efforts, championing experimentation standards, modeling best practices, and innovation in content strategy. You Have - 8+ years of experience in data science, analytics, or a related field, with a proven track record of solving complex product and business problems. - Strong foundation in statistical and machine learning techniques, including supervised and unsupervised modeling approaches. - Advanced proficiency in SQL and Python, with hands-on experience building machine learning models and analytical workflows. - Experience working with large-scale datasets, developing scalable data pipelines, and building reusable modeling frameworks. - Deep expertise in A/B testing, causal inference, and quasi-experimental methods. - Excellent communication skills, with the ability to translate complex analyses into clear, actionable insights for diverse stakeholders. - A product-oriented mindset, with strong ownership and the ability to influence cross-functional partners. - Experience with financial modeling or content ROI frameworks is a plus.
